Texture – be it lace, broderie anglaise, or sheers fabric texture dominates this season. Influenced in no small part by Kate’s stunning royal lace wedding dress from Alexander McQueen, any fabric with a handcrafted or textured feel is desirable. Delicious Candy Colours are the colour palette of S/S 2012. Sweet, feminine and oh so lady-like these pretty pastels have a genteel aura while demure styling details emphasise the retro influence that inspired them. Think Mad Men meets Pan Am meets Audrey Hepburn. Prints – S/S 2012 is the season of the statement print – forget restraint and under-statement , the bigger and bolder the better is the message for this season. All-over print, clashing prints, florals, fauna, and animal skins - are all defining the look sometimes as a collage effect in the one garment. Peplums – A wave of peplums was seen on the S/S 2012 catwalks as part of the strong retro influence of the season. At La Crème, Heidi Higgin’s darling dresses feature pretty peplums that add just the right degree of flirtatious femininity to their streamlined silhouette. It’s a little bit ‘80s and a little bit ‘40s at the same time but utterly divine!

Aquatic hues – Everything aquatic is the buzz for S/S 2012 – think of a palette of cerulean blues, aqua greens and turquoises highlighted with solid whites.
